    There is another way  without itunes Restore:

    1- Make sure your iPhone is at latest iOS

    2- Backup your iPhone (Preferred on Cloud)

    3- from you iPhone go to: settings - general - reset - reset all media and settings - WILL PERMANENTLY  DELETE everything from your iPhone.

    4- Connect your iPhone to iTunes - it will tell you "Congratulations .. you iPhone is unlocked"

    5- Setup your iPhone by restoring your backup (preferred from cloud as in #2).

     

    it will take you time to restore your iPhone but it is easier than restoring through iTunes
